Digital Assets (Cryptocurrency) Taxable Income and Gains
According to the IRS, a digital asset is property, not currency. Therefore, a digital asset is a capital asset. Furthermore, the IRS defines a digital asset as any digital representation of value recorded on a cryptographically secured, distributed ledger (blockchain) or similar technology. Examples of digital assets are Bitcoin, Dogecoin, Ether, Tether, and Non-fungible tokens […]
Business Taxes and Payroll Deadlines
Businesses have specific deadlines for reporting income and payroll taxes. These deadlines include quarterly and annual filings with the IRS. Businesses must adhere to these deadlines or face penalties for late or missed filings.
